  Light does not care
  whether you bend and shape metal reflectors or solve a Monge-Ampere 
  problem (the latter is currently responsible for 90% of all publications but 
  less than 5% of installations). 
  Customers don't really care 
  whether you set up a Poisson bracket in the phase space or you devise a 
  thin lens from basic laws as long as the specification is fulfilled. 
  Yes, sometimes there is not even a specs.
  Successful Illumination Design 
  considerably benefits from mastering a wide variety of techniques.
  This website is part of some activities of the hosts to bring a few things 
  closer together :
